Definition of Exit

noun

  1. An act of going out or going away, or leaving; a departure.

    "He made his exit at the opportune time."

  2. A way out.
  3. The act of departing from life; death.

    "the untimely exit of a respected politician"

verb

  1. To go out or go away from a place or situation; to depart, to leave.
  2. To depart from life; to die.
  3. To end or terminate (a program, subroutine, etc.)
  4. (originally United States) To depart from or leave (a place or situation).
